Output c37912e98e62c2e38b9ddaf04c7a633635fe3efff3b291017ff1a017bbe319ae:2

value
25538081380
script pubkey
OP_0 OP_PUSHBYTES_20 3e356855f0543c4c15e155d690ad6d76b236e33e
address
bc1q8c6ks40s2s7yc90p2htfpttdw6erdce7axy2wt
transaction
c37912e98e62c2e38b9ddaf04c7a633635fe3efff3b291017ff1a017bbe319ae